# if no OBJCOPY or not needed, this can be set to true (or false)
OBJCOPY ?= objcopy

# We expect $(BIN_LD) -o foo.o foo.luac to create a foo.o with the
# content of foo.luac as a data section (plus appropriate symbols).
# GNU LD and compatible linkers (including recent clang lld) should be
# fine with -r -b binary, but this does break on some ports.

BIN_LD ?= $(LD) -r -b binary

# If BIN_ARCH and BIN_FMT are defined, we assume LD_BINARY is broken
# and do this instead. This is apparently needed for linux-mips64el,
# for which BIN_ARCH=mips:isa64r2 BIN_FMT=elf64-tradlittlemips seems
# to work.

ifdef BIN_ARCH
ifdef BIN_FMT
BIN_LD = $(REORDER_O) $(OBJCOPY) -B $(BIN_ARCH) -I binary -O $(BIN_FMT)
endif
endif
